The Geological Nature and Identification of Raw Emeralds

Identifying a raw emerald in its natural state requires a keen eye for crystal habit and an understanding of the mineral's relationship with its host rock. The primary identifying characteristic of an emerald is its habit, which is defined as a hexagonal prism. When a gemstone grows in the earth, it follows specific atomic arrangements that result in this six-sided geometric structure. If a rough stone exhibits this hexagonal growth without evidence of artificial polishing, it is a strong indicator of a natural emerald.

However, nature is rarely uniform. While the hexagonal prism is the ideal formation, the actual growth process is often erratic, influenced by the random distribution of elements in the crust and the fluctuating temperatures and pressures over millennia. Consequently, many raw emeralds may appear irregular or fragmented rather than as perfect prisms. A critical diagnostic feature is the presence of the matrix, or the pieces of the rocks on which the emerald naturally formed. For example, calcite is a common associate of emeralds; finding raw emerald crystals still embedded in a calcite matrix is a hallmark of an authentic, natural specimen.

For those seeking to verify the identity of a raw stone, specific technical tests are employed, most notably the streak test. This process involves dragging the gemstone across an unglazed porcelain plate. The resulting powder, or "streak," reveals the true color of the mineral, which is essential for distinguishing emeralds from other green minerals. This test is strictly reserved for uncut stones because it is destructive; it removes a small portion of the gemstone and would destroy the polish and value of a faceted gem.

Global Provenance and Sourcing Regions

The origin of a raw emerald significantly influences its chemical composition, color profile, and market value. The world's most renowned mining regions provide diverse varieties of rough material, each with distinct characteristics.

Colombia remains a legendary source, with the Muzo and Chivor regions producing some of the most coveted emeralds in the world. These stones are prized for their rich, saturated colors. Brazil also serves as a primary source of rough emeralds, contributing significant volumes to the global market. In Africa, Zambia is a leading producer, often providing stones with a different color saturation than those from South America.

Beyond these traditional hubs, other regions provide exceptional mineral specimens. The Swat Valley and Chitral in Pakistan, as well as the Panjshir Valley in Afghanistan, are recognized for producing high-quality natural emeralds. These regions often supply wholesale dealers with facet-grade rough and unique mineral specimens that are highly sought after by collectors and lapidary artists.

The complexity of sourcing is not limited to geology but extends to legality and ethics. In certain regions, particularly in South America, the emerald trade has been marred by the involvement of gangs and corrupt officials using forced labor in unproductive mines. This creates a critical need for certification. Legal certification ensures that a stone was mined legally and traded fairly, which is a prerequisite for stability and legitimacy in the international gemstone market.

Classification of Raw Emerald Quality and Value

The value of a raw emerald is significantly lower than that of a faceted emerald, primarily because the interior of a rough stone is a mystery until it is cut. The process of transformation from rough to faceted is a high-risk venture, as the lapidary does not know the exact quality of the internal inclusions until the stone is opened.

Grading and Transparency Tiers

The quality of raw emerald material is categorized based on its transparency and intended use. Not all emeralds are gem-quality; they range from opaque minerals to transparent crystals.

Grade Transparency Level Primary Use
Facet-Grade Transparent High-end jewelry, faceted gemstones
Cabochon-Grade Translucent to Semi-Transparent Rounded, polished stones (cabochons)
Carving-Grade Opaque to Translucent Intricate carvings and ornaments

Facet-grade material is the rarest and most expensive because it possesses the clarity necessary to allow light to pass through the stone, which is the primary requirement for a luxury faceted gem.

The Role of Color in Valuation

Color is the most significant driver of value in an emerald, and it can be evaluated even before the stone is cut. The "emerald green" is not a single static shade but a spectrum.

  • Bluish-Green: This is the most preferred hue, as it represents the highest quality and most desirable emeralds.
  • Pure Green: Highly valued and classic.
  • Yellowish-Green: These are generally less valuable because they closely resemble peridot, another green gemstone. High-quality emeralds may have a faint yellowish tint, but significant yellow tones diminish the stone's classification as a premium emerald.

While faceted gems are evaluated using the 4Cs (Color, Clarity, Cut, and Carat weight), uncut emeralds cannot be precisely measured by cut or final carat weight, as these are determined during the lapidary process. Therefore, the initial valuation focuses heavily on the estimated internal color and the overall crystal integrity.

Technical Applications and Uses of Uncut Emeralds

Rough emeralds serve a variety of purposes beyond the traditional goal of creating a faceted gemstone. The utility of these stones extends into art, science, and metaphysical practices.

  • Jewelry Creation: Designers use raw emeralds to create bespoke pieces. This can involve transforming a rough stone into a faceted pendant or ring, or leaving the stone in its natural, uncut state to highlight its organic beauty.
  • Gemstone Study: For gemologists and students of the lapidary arts, rough emeralds are essential tools. They allow the student to study the natural crystal growth patterns and the process of removing the matrix to reveal the gem within.
  • Investment: Raw emeralds can be an accessible entry point for investors. Because they are unprocessed, they are often available at lower prices than faceted stones, offering a way to acquire high-quality mineral wealth that may appreciate as the stone is later cut or as the scarcity of natural emeralds increases.
  • Crystal Healing: In metaphysical beliefs, emeralds are associated with the promotion of love, harmony, and spiritual growth. Practitioners often use raw crystals for these purposes, believing the unpolished state maintains a stronger connection to the Earth's energy.
  • Mineral Collections: Some emeralds are kept as rare mineral specimens. While rare, well-formed crystals that occur naturally in an ideal shape are exceptionally valuable, akin to winning a lottery.

The Economics of the Emerald Trade

The transition of an emerald from a mine to a buyer involves a complex chain of logistics and costs. Beyond the inherent value of the mineral, several external factors influence the final price of a raw emerald parcel.

International shipping, insurance, and customs duties add significant overhead to the cost of importing rough stones from regions like Colombia or Zambia. Furthermore, the market is bifurcated between retail buyers and wholesale operations. Wholesale dealers often deal in parcels, which may include a mix of facet-grade rough, cabbing material, and lower-grade mineral specimens. This allows for scaling operations for jewelry businesses and lapidary artists.

A notable example of the volatility and complexity of the emerald market is the Bahia Emerald. Weighing 752 pounds, it is the largest emerald ever known, though its quality is considered low. Its history is a cautionary tale of ownership disputes and legal battles, involving claims by the Brazilian government that the stone was illegally smuggled out of the country. This illustrates that even the most massive specimens can be subject to extreme legal instability.
